Virginia residents, some with tractors, protest Dominion power line and demand it be buried
Residents of western Prince William County in Northern Virginia gathered outside a high school — some arriving on tractors — to object to Dominion Energy's proposed transmission line, InsideNoVa reported. What's happening? At the center of the dispute is Dominion Energy's proposal for a 230-kilovolt transmission line stretching 6.5 miles from Nokesville to Bristow, a plan that has drawn intense pushback. Tanya Tucker testifies, sings at Texas Senate committee hearing on massive power line project
Tanya Tucker showed up at a special hearing hosted by the Senate Committee on Business and Commerce to discuss the state grid and a proposed 765-kilovolt transmission line network tied to the Permian Basin Reliability Plan.

Citizens and municipalities continue to oppose 765 kV transmission line
DRIFTLESS - Citizens opposing construction of the state’s proposed largest transmission lines through the Driftless Region - MariBell and BECI 765 kV lines – have continued to work with potentially impacted landowners and municipalities.
